AAP turns down Vaiko’s invite to fight TN polls

A day after MDMK chief and coordinator of PWF-DMDK combine Vaiko met the state leaderhip of Aam Aadmi party (AAP) here, the Arvind Kejriwal-led party on Friday said it would not be possible for it to extend support to any alliance or party in Tamil Nadu for the May 16 Assembly election.

In a letter addressed to Vaiko, AAP leader and in-charge for TN, Somnath Bharti said his party “has keenly been watching the political developments in Tamil Nadu”.  “It won’t be possible for the party to extend support to any alliance or party in the state for the upcoming elections,” he said. 

Though he referred to a letter sent by Vaiko to Kejriwal, he did not make references to its contents. Before he shot off a letter, Vaiko met the AAP state convenor Vaseegaran on Thursday and the 
MDMK had described it as a “courtesy call”.
